Phone Calls to a Georgia Inmate | State Prisons and County Jails

How to call a Georgia GDC inmate. Securus statewide at $0.08/min, no deposit fees. Georgia has 159 counties each with its own jail vendor.

Georgia has two separate phone systems. The Georgia Department of Corrections (GDC) operates all state prisons under a single statewide contract with Securus Technologies. Georgia's 159 counties each operate their own jails and contract phone services independently.

GDC uses "offenders" throughout its official materials. The state prison system is one of the largest in the country, housing nearly 60,000 adults under incarceration.

PART 1 - GEORGIA STATE PRISONS (GDC)

The Georgia Department of Corrections contracts with Securus Technologies for all phone services at state prison facilities statewide.

How GDC phone calls work

Offenders place outgoing calls only. You cannot call into the facility to reach an offender. The offender calls from a facility phone to numbers on their Call Allow List. When a call connects, a pre-recorded announcement plays identifying the facility. You then accept or decline.

Call Allow List: All calls are restricted to numbers on the offender's approved Call Allow List. The offender manages their list. Your number must appear on it before you can receive any calls.

All calls are subject to monitoring and recording. Call forwarding and three-way calling are not permitted. Maximum call length is 25 minutes per call.

Setting up a Securus account

Online: securustech.net

Phone: 1-800-844-6591 (Securus customer service)

Three account types are available:

Pre-Paid Collect: You fund an account tied to your phone number. The offender calls your number and costs are deducted from your balance. Multiple telephone numbers can be added to one pre-paid collect account.

Direct Bill: Costs are billed directly to you through Securus Correctional Billing Services. A credit check is required.

Debit Calling: The offender transfers money from their trust account to a Securus debit calling account in $1 increments to fund their own calls. Offenders can call any number on their Call Allow List using debit funds.

Calling rates - GDC statewide (Securus contract)

| Call Type | Per Minute Rate | Cost of 25-Minute Call |

|---------------|------------------------------|------------------------------|

| Local | $0.08/min | $2.00 |

| Long Distance | $0.08/min | $2.00 |

| International | $0.08/min + international fees | $2.00 + international fees |

Rates do not include associated taxes or regulatory fees.

Funding fees

There are no funding fees of any kind for Pre-Paid Collect accounts:

- IVR, website, or online deposit: $0.00

- Live agent deposit: $0.00

- Check or money order deposit: $0.00

Maximum deposit: $200.00 per transaction.

Note on FCC rate caps: The FCC 2025 IPCS Order (effective April 6, 2026) caps large prisons at $0.10/min plus $0.02 facility additive. Georgia's $0.08/min rate is below that ceiling.

Video visits and messaging - JPay

GDC offers video visits and electronic messaging through JPay (a Securus subsidiary). JPay handles the video visit and messaging platform separately from the Securus phone system. Video visit accounts are set up through JPay. A 30-minute video visit is approximately $3.95.

Legal calls

Attorney calls at GDC facilities are handled under confidentiality protections. To arrange unmonitored attorney calls, attorneys should contact the specific facility directly.

PART 2 - GEORGIA COUNTY JAILS (159 counties)

Georgia has 159 counties - more than any state except Texas. Each county operates its own jail independently from the GDC. The vendor, rates, rules, and setup process vary by county. A Securus account funded for a GDC state prison does not work at a county jail, even at jails that also use Securus.

Georgia counties have historically paid very high commission rates to their phone providers - averaging around 59.6% of gross call revenue going back to counties as kickbacks. This contributes to higher per-minute rates at many county jails. The FCC 2025 IPCS Order (effective April 6, 2026) now caps county jail rates regardless of commission arrangements.

How to find the current vendor for a county jail

Go to the county sheriff's official website and look for pages labeled "Inmate Telephone," "Inmate Services," "Jail," or "Visitation." The vendor name, website, and customer service number will be listed there. If not found online, call the jail directly. Vendor contracts change; always verify before setting up an account.

Major vendors at Georgia county jails

ICSolutions: Used at Fulton County Jail (since May 15, 2024) and Clayton County Prison. Setup at icsolutions.com; 1-888-506-8407.

Securus Technologies: Used at Gwinnett County Jail and others. Setup at securustech.net; 1-800-844-6591.

ViaPath / ConnectNetwork (formerly GTL): Used at some Georgia county jails. Setup at connectnetwork.com; 877-650-4249.

Notable county examples (verify before relying on this information)

Fulton County Jail (Atlanta):

Switched from Securus to ICSolutions effective May 15, 2024.

Current vendor: ICSolutions (icsolutions.com | 1-888-506-8407)

Video visits: 30 minutes; inmates receive up to 2 video visits per day depending on floor location

Payments also accepted: Visa/MasterCard, Western Union, money orders/cashier's checks

Mail-in payments: ICSolutions, Attention Customer Service, 2200 Danbury Street, San Antonio TX 78217

Attorney calls: contact Jail Security Office at 404-613-2181 before accepting calls to register for unrecorded calls

Fulton County Jail main: 404-613-2024

Clayton County Prison (Corrections Department):

Current vendor: ICSolutions (customer@icsolutions.com)

Approved list: up to 10 numbers; submitted by inmate on arrival

Phone hours: Monday-Friday 4:30pm-9:45pm; weekends and holidays 8:00am-11:00pm

Daily limits: 30 minutes on weekdays; 40 minutes on weekends

What to do before the first call

For a GDC state prison:

1. Find the offender's GDC number and current facility at gdc.georgia.gov/offender-info/find-offender

2. Ask the offender to add your phone number to their Call Allow List

3. Set up a Securus account at securustech.net or by calling 1-800-844-6591

4. Fund your Pre-Paid Collect account (or fund the offender's Debit account if using that method)

5. Wait for the offender to initiate the call

For a Georgia county jail:

1. Find the inmate through the county jail's inmate search or the county sheriff's website

2. Identify the current phone vendor from the jail's official website

3. Create an account with that vendor only

4. Add funds

5. Confirm with the inmate that your number is on their approved list

6. Wait for the inmate to call
